Solve the equation x4 – 26x2 + 25 = 0 in the real number system.
gogolik [260]

Answer:

x = -1, 1, -5 , 5.

Step-by-step explanation:

x4 – 26x2 + 25 = 0

Factoring:

(x^2 - 25)(x^2 - 1) = 0

So x^2 - 25 = 0 gives x^2 = 25 and x = +/- 5.

x^2 - 1  gives  x^2 = 1 and x = +/- 1.

The doubling period of a bacteria population is 10 minutes. At time t = 110 minutes, the bacterial population was 800.
goldenfox [79]

The initial population at time t = 0 was 0.39 while the size of the bacteria population after 4 hours was 6553600

<h3>What is an equation?</h3>

An equation is an expression that shows the relationship between two or more numbers and variables.

Let y represent the bacteria population at time t. a represent the initial population at t = 0. Since the doubling period of a bacteria population is 10 minutes, hence:

y=a(2)^\frac{t}{10}

At time t = 110 minutes, the bacterial population was 800. Hence:

800=a(2)^\frac{110}{10} \\\\a = 0.39

At 4 hours (240 minutes):

y=0.39(2)^\frac{240}{10} =6553600

The initial population at time t = 0 was 0.39 while the size of the bacteria population after 4 hours was 6553600

A road has a 10% grade, meaning increasing 1 unit of rise to every 10 units of run.
fenix001 [56]

The grade is the ratio of rise to run, i.e. the slope aka the tangent.

\tan \theta = \dfrac{1}{10}

\theta = \arctan 0.1 \approx 5.711^\circ

Answer: (a) 6 degrees

For part b, the road is the hypotenuse c of a right triangle whose tangent of the small angle is 1/10.    The height h or rise is the side opposite the small angle.

\sin\theta = \dfrac h c

h = c \sin \theta

We could just take the sine of the angle we got but let's get it from the tangent exactly.

\cos^2 \theta + \sin ^2 \theta = 1

Dividing by squared cosine

1 + \tan ^2 \theta = 1/\cos^2 \theta = 1/(1- \sin^2 \theta)

(1- \sin^2 \theta) = 1/(1 + \tan^2 \theta)

\sin^2 \theta = 1 - 1/(1 + \tan^2 \theta)

\sin^2 \theta = 1 - 1/(1 + (1/10)^2) = 1-1/(101/100) = 1/101

h = c \sin \theta = 2 \sqrt{1/101} \approx 0.199

Answer: (b) Rise of 0.199 km
